Week 7

The aspect of week seven that I found most valuable was on Friday when I was able to teach the same lesson twice. I picked up my fourth class on Friday which is another accounting class. I was able to teach the lesson and learn from the lesson about what worked and what I could do to improve it before the next class and make any changes if I needed to. I did make a few changes with my lesson the second time around. I pointed out a few things about the posting of the special journals that were different then what they learned in the previous chapters about posting. I also felt that I have become more comfortable with all my classes this week and that it really showed in my teaching. I was able to incorporate better introductions then I previously have.

If I could go back to the beginning of the week and change anything it would be to make sure that the students are really prepared for the tests. We review in accounting and go over the problems for four or five days before the test. When test time comes some students do very poorly and some do very well. I am going to try and think of ways to improve some test grades for accounting.
